Quality Software Developer Advanced Training Logo

Quality Software Developer Advanced Training

Live Online & Classroom Enterprise Certification Training

Powered By

PeopleCert Logo

A professional certification and training path designed for team leads, architects and senior developers, aiming to establish and lead software development practices that consistently produce high-quality, maintainable software.

ATP_Authorized Logo

Powered By

PeopleCert Logo
COURSE BROCHURE DOWNLOAD PDF

Looking for a private batch ?

REQUEST A CALLBACK

Need help finding the right training?

Your Message

  • Certified Trainer

  • Authorized Courseware

  • Completion Certificate from ATP

  • Enterprise Reporting

  • Lifetime Access

  • CloudLabs

  • 24x7 Support

  • Real-time code analysis and feedback

What is Quality Software Developer Advanced Certification Training about?

The QSD Advanced course builds on foundational software maintainability themes and extends to team, process and organisational level practices. Participants learn how to organise software development teams, implement measurable quality practices, define workflows and tools, and embed a culture of maintainability and high software quality across the lifecycle. It is about not just writing good code but enabling others and the whole process to deliver quality software.

What are the objectives of Quality Software Developer Advanced Certification Training ?

  • Understand how to create and improve the development process and tools so your team can build high quality, maintainable software. 
  • Lead software development teams with measurable quality metrics and best-practice frameworks in place. 
  • Define, deploy and monitor quality practices and workflows (e.g., version control, automated tests, code reviews, continuous integration) that support maintainability at scale. 
  • Embed a culture of maintainability and software quality across the organisation — beyond individual developers. 
  • Make strategic decisions about tooling, architecture, team structure, metrics and processes to reduce technical debt and improve development predictability. 

Who is Quality Software Developer Advanced Certification Training for?

  • Senior software developers or engineers who are moving into team-lead, architect or process-owner roles.
  • Team leads, technical managers, scrum masters or development managers responsible for software quality and maintainability.
  • Architects or lead engineers who need to embed maintainable code practices across teams and projects.
  • Professionals responsible for defining development workflows, metrics, tooling and quality assurance practices in software development.

What are the prerequisites for Quality Software Developer Advanced Certification Training?

  • The foundation certification level (i.e., the QSD Foundation certificate) or equivalent knowledge of maintainability and quality practices. 
  • Several years (e.g., at least 2 years) of development experience and familiarity with object-oriented programming, code maintainability issues and refactoring. 
  • Experience working in software development teams; ideally with exposure to code reviews, version control, testing and deployment processes.
  • Understanding of basic software quality metrics, technical debt, maintainability challenges and coding best practices.

Available Training Modes

Live Online Training

3 Days

Who is the instructor for this training?

The trainer for this Quality Software Developer Advanced Training has extensive experience in this domain, including years of experience training & mentoring professionals.

Course Logo

Quality Software Developer Advanced Certification Training - Certification & Exam

  • SpringPeople is the Authorized Training Partner of PeopleCert.
  • The training fees is exclusive of exam cost.
  • For any queries, feel free to reach us at PeopleCert@springpeople.com

Reviews